Transaction ec591b68eeeb70e1a9070104c714e70b60138466ba7576b2d25de9270ec8149f
1 Input
1 Output
-
ec591b68eeeb70e1a9070104c714e70b60138466ba7576b2d25de9270ec8149f:0
- value
- 9944890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4556eb1939edf9fb5a951eead4d685da1b426410 OP_EQUAL
- address
- 381efyPtyBPZsPpvqs3br9Cox4Jf5LMFYW